Iranian envoy urges Britain to react to U.S. attacks on Iran

June 24, 2025

Ambassador to London Ali Mousavi has called on the British government to adopt a clear stance regarding the United States’ act of aggression against Iran.

In a meeting with Britain’s Parliamentary Under-Secretary of State at the Foreign, Commonwealth, and Development Office, Hamish Falconer, Mousavi urged the British government to take a clear and responsible position regarding the U.S. aggression against Iran’s nuclear facilities.

According to Iran’s embassy in London. Mousavi met with Falconer on Monday to express his serious concern about the illegal U.S. military attacks on the Islamic Republic’s peaceful nuclear infrastructure. He described this move as an act of aggression and a blatant violation of international law.

The ambassador called on the under-secretary not to remain silent in the face of measures that weaken international law, particularly the U.N. Charter.

He also stated that Iran reserves its legitimate right to respond to this aggression at an appropriate time and in a manner consistent with Article 51 of the U.N. Charter.

In response, the British official expressed his country’s deep concern about the escalation of tensions, stating that Britain will not contribute to the attacks. He also called for de-escalation and the return of all parties to diplomacy.

The U.S. conducted airstrikes on the Fordow, Natanz, and Isfahan nuclear sites early Sunday.
